Overcast this morning, turning into partly cloudy skies and 10 miles visibility.  Winds were on 3kts and the sea surface had a bit of light chop.  The air temperature was 64.0˚ and the water was 66.6˚ at the buoy.  High tide was at 7:23am +3.4' and low tide will be at 11:47am +2.4'.  Next week the tidal swings become more pronounced and we get set up for the autumnal fluctuations in September.  We have a SSW swell out of 190˚ at 3.0'.  It's 1' to 2' and poor to fair.  Lately, the wind has been blowing early and then dying around 8 to 9am.  Maybe mañana with a more cooperative tide...
